Luton Town were relegated from the Premier League after just one season following their meteoric rise to the top.

The Hatters won over a lot of people with their plucky spirit and their rejuvenation of Ross Barkley, but it wasn't enough to keep them in the league.

They will of course be hoping to bounce back up again next season, but that might have just got a little bit more difficult.

A report today has revealed that Luton Town have appointed former Newcastle man Danny Murphy after he left the club in January.

Training Ground Guru has revealed that Murphy has joined Luton as their head of medical eight months after his New Year's Day departure from the Magpies.

Under Murphy, Newcastle's squad was decimated by injuries last season and after an extended leave of absence, Murphy left the club in January.

The report at the time suggested it was a mutual parting of the ways, but given how bad Newcastle were suffering with injuries, we could see a strong case that he was pushed.

Obviously, bad luck played a part in Newcastle's injury crisis, and even though Murphy was on extended leave, his staff were following his protocols so he can't be entirely blameless.

Thankfully Newcastle have appointed James Bunce who worked with Paul Mitchell at Monaco when Mitchell arrived there under the cloud of a huge injury crisis.

Bunce was able to put things right at Monaco and we're all hoping he can do the same at Newcastle, although we're aware it won't be an overnight fix.
